The fee structure for B.Tech. In Ravenshaw University is as follows:
General Category: 1,71,000/- per year
OBC Category: 1,56,000/- per year
SC/ST Category: 1,41,000/- per year
The fee structure includes tuition fees, hostel fees, mess fees, and other miscellaneous fees. The fee structure may vary depending on the course and the year of admission. In addition to the regular fee, students may also have to pay additional fees for certain activities, such as laboratory fees, library fees, and sports fees. The exact amount of these fees will vary depending on the activity.

Bennett University has a good placement record for B.Tech in CSE students. In the recent placement season, the highest package offered to students was around INR 1.2 crore per annum, while the average package offered was INR 11.1 LPA. More than 190 companies participated in the placement drive at Bennett University, and over 90% of students were placed in top companies, namely Aditya Birla, HDFC Bank, HCL, and others.
